The STARRETT 20726 is a welded bi-metal bandsaw blade from the Intenss PRO series, built for continuous cutting of ferrous and non-ferrous metals. It measures 174 inches (14 feet 6 inches) in length, 1-1/4 inches in width, and 0.042 inches in thickness. The blade runs a variable pitch of 2-3 TPI with a raker tooth set and a positive rake angle, which reduces vibration and helps maintain consistent chip load across a range of material thicknesses. High speed steel teeth are electron-beam welded to a flexible alloy steel back, giving the blade both edge retention and resistance to fatigue cracking under tension. This blade is designed for metal-cutting vertical or horizontal bandsaws that accept a 174-inch (14 feet 6 inches) loop blade with a 1-1/4-inch width. The variable 2-3 TPI pitch makes it well suited for structural steel, solid bar stock, tubing, and angle iron, as well as non-ferrous materials such as aluminum and copper alloy sections. It is appropriate for both production cutting environments and job-shop applications where the operator needs a single blade that handles variable cross-sections without frequent blade changes.

Blade installation should be performed by a qualified machinist or maintenance technician with the bandsaw fully de-energized and locked out per OSHA lockout/tagout procedures. Verify wheel tracking, blade tension, and guide bearing clearance according to the saw manufacturer's specifications before powering the machine. Wear cut-resistant gloves when handling the coiled blade during installation. Inspect weld integrity and blade back for cracks or kinks before mounting.
